Peter Conley 1884–1958 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: Jan 1884

Birth Location: West Virginia

Death Date: 9 Oct 1958

Death Location: Orlando, Braxton, West Virginia, United States

Father: Thomas Conley

Mother: Ellen Conley

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1884, Peter Conley entered the world in West Virginia, born to Thomas Conley And Ellen Conley. In 1900, Peter Conley resided in Salt Lick, Braxton, West Virginia, USA. Peter Conley passed away in 1958 in Orlando, Braxton, West Virginia, United States.
